Basic FireBase Skeleton Code
package Firebase.Skeleton;
import android.app.Activity;
import android.net.Uri;
import android.os.Bundle;
import android.support.annotation.NonNull;
import android.util.Log;
import android.widget.Toast;
import com.google.android.gms.tasks.OnCompleteListener;
import com.google.android.gms.tasks.Task;
import com.google.firebase.auth.AuthResult;
import com.google.firebase.auth.FirebaseAuth;
import com.google.firebase.auth.FirebaseUser;
//FireData Is For All FireBase Management, Auth+Data
public class FireData extends Activity
{
private static final String TAG = "TBug";
private FirebaseAuth FireAuth;
private String UserName,UserEmail,ImgSRC,UserPass;
@Override
protected void onCreate(Bundle savedInstanceState)
{
super.onCreate(savedInstanceState);
FireAuth = FirebaseAuth.getInstance();
}
@Override
public void onStart()
{
super.onStart();
//Current User Info
FirebaseUser user = FirebaseAuth.getInstance().getCurrentUser();
if (user != null)
{
// Name, email address, and profile photo Url
String UserName = user.getDisplayName();
String UserEmail = user.getEmail();
Uri imgSRC = user.getPhotoUrl();
// Check if user's email is verified
boolean Verified = user.isEmailVerified();
// The user's ID, unique to the Firebase project. Do NOT use this value to
// authenticate with your backend server, if you have one. Use
// FirebaseUser.getToken() instead.
String UID = user.getUid();
// Check if user is signed in (non-null) and update UI accordingly.
FirebaseUser currentUser = FireAuth.getCurrentUser();
updateUI(currentUser);
}
}
private void Regestration()
{
FireAuth.createUserWithEmailAndPassword(UserName,UserPass)
.addOnCompleteListener(this, new OnCompleteListener<AuthResult>()
{
@Override
public void onComplete(@NonNull Task<AuthResult> task)
{
if (task.isSuccessful())
{
// Sign in success, update UI with the signed-in user's information
Log.d(TAG, "createUserWithEmail:success");
FirebaseUser user = FireAuth.getCurrentUser();
updateUI(user);
}
else
{
// If sign in fails, display a message to the user.
Log.w(TAG, "createUserWithEmail:failure", task.getException());
Toast.makeText(getBaseContext().getApplicationContext(), "Authentication failed.",
Toast.LENGTH_SHORT).show();
updateUI(null);
}
// ...
}
});
}
//Handle Google Login Here
private void Authentication()
{
}
//Update UserInfo Here
private void updateUI(FirebaseUser currentUser)
{
//ToDo: RTL DB SYNCING
}
}
